Reframing the Buffer State in Contemporary International Relations: Nepal’s Relations with India and China - Rethinking Asia and International Relations
Chand, Bibek (University of North Georgia, USA)
This book explores buffer states' agency beyond being highly interactive spaces for the competing strategic and security interests of larger powers. Analysing twenty-one political events the author offers a new conceptual framework for the buffer state, which emphasizes strategic utility and agency of the buffer state.
